I Education Apps Review is now a community of over 500 educators, administrators and app developers.
Site includes reviews of apps, cool tools, app grading, student reviews, search field, and app of the week to name a few features.

Policy Challenges in Online Learning
From Educause Policy Matters
Educause Online Learning Challenges: State Authorization and Federal Regulation
by Jarrett Cummins
October 24, 2011
"In the interim, traditional colleges and universities will continue to face the unintended consequences of federal action in the form of increased financial and administrative burdens, providing significant motivation for collective engagement by federal, state, and institutional stakeholders to develop a regulatory structure that works for online learning."

"United States is losing ground to other industrialized nations. Over several decades, we’ve slipped from first to seventh among the nations of the Organization for Economic Co-operation and Development in the percentage of adults aged 25 to 34 with bachelor’s degrees and to ninth in the number of adults in that age range with at least a high school education."

"Degree completion is most affected by SES, high school-based academic resources, degree aspirations, enrollment patterns, taking college courses in math and sciences, financial aid, and having children while attending college."
Pathways to a Four-Year Degree: Determinants of Degree Completion among Socioeconomically Disadvantaged Students http://35.8.168.242/paperdepot/2003cabrera.pdf
